Glenerrick House is in the heart of the Scottish Highlands, the perfect balance between glorious luxury and the rugged beauty of the surrounding mountains and Lochs. A large country house set in an elevated position overlooking beautiful mountains and close to Loch Knockie and Loch Ness. The perfect getaway.
Relax in one of our two hot tubs and bbq your favourites on the deck, or if the Scottish weather has you preferring the inside, cosy up by one of the wood fires in the living rooms. Our property is a spacious and comfortable 8 bedroom home with 3 reception rooms and dining options inside or out on the decking. (There are 3 superking bedrooms and 5 king bedrooms. In two of the bedrooms, the beds can be separated into twins upon request.) The castle-like turret, the quality finishes inside, and underfloor heating throughout the downstairs, and beautifully presented interiors show the careful planning in the design of our home. The kitchens come with a complete range of units, hobs, and integrated appliances as you would expect, double oven, dishwasher and the main kitchen has a wine cooler. We are almost completely emissions free using solar panels, solar hot water and air source heat pumps. There is a gated driveway which leads up to the courtyard where there is ample parking. The garden area is large, with a pond, sauna pod, wood store and beautiful views. (Please note the pond has a fence around it with a latch gate, it has a couple of benches beside it to relax on, but please supervise children at all times.)
This house is somewhere to have a fantastic holiday whilst embracing the rugged beauty and timeless enchantment of the Scottish Highlands. Glenerrick House is a short drive to the shores of Loch Ness and is set in some of the region’s finest scenery at the foot of the Monadhliath Mountains. There are amazing viewpoints for photos near by, there are hiking and bicycle trails, there is a cafe nearby where you can have a delicious brunch while watching the numerous Highland Cows. You can drive to Inverness for shopping or beauticians, or to Drumnadrochit for a boat trip on Loch Ness to spot Nessie! There are castles, distilleries, Foyers waterfall, eateries, Dores beach, and much more in daytrip distance. You don't need to travel to the Kincraig Scottish Wildlife park, our garden is regularly visited by the local deer, grouse and pheasants, and a host of local birds.
